Why do production servers and test servers have to be similar?

Aligning production and test servers is a simple step that leads to more effective testing, smoother deployments, and happier users.

Helping to catch issues before they reach users.

Similar servers allow for early bug detection, preventing surprises in the live environment.

Deployment is smoother when test environments resemble production, reducing the risk of failures.
